Celtics star Jaylen Brown fined $35K for officiating criticism
NegativeSports

- Boston Celtics guard Jaylen Brown has been fined $35,000 for publicly criticizing the officiating crew following the team's 100-95 loss to the San Antonio Spurs. Brown's comments came after a game where he expressed frustration over the referees' decisions, which he felt impacted the outcome.
- This fine underscores the NBA's stance on maintaining respect for officials and discouraging public criticism, which can influence player behavior and team dynamics. Brown's willingness to pay the fine reflects his commitment to standing by his beliefs.
- The incident highlights ongoing tensions within the league regarding officiating standards and player conduct, as Brown has faced scrutiny for both his on-court performance and off-court comments. This situation is part of a broader narrative in the NBA, where players increasingly voice their frustrations about officiating, raising questions about accountability and the impact of such fines on player expression.
